Abstract

Equality of opportunity has essentially been defined since the 1789 French Revolution as access to the same body of knowledge, culture, language, and societal institutions. The public space, such as schools, social services, and political institutions, is intended to protect all citizens, young and old, from nonsecular influences (la laicité) and diversity that may contribute to disunity. These two pillars of France’s unique and consistent approach to all minority, migrant, and long-standing French populations need to be well understood to fully appreciate the experience children of migrant heritage have in the country today.
